About Xin Zou
Xin Zou is a scholar working on General Engineering, Management Science and Operations Research and Industrial and Manufacturing Engineering, having authored 38 papers that have together received 841 indexed citations. Recurring topics across this work include Resource-Constrained Project Scheduling (19 papers), Scheduling and Optimization Algorithms (12 papers) and BIM and Construction Integration (10 papers). The work is most often cited by research in Management Science and Operations Research (255 citations), Building and Construction (228 citations) and Industrial and Manufacturing Engineering (118 citations). Xin Zou has collaborated with scholars based in China, Australia and Singapore. Frequent co-authors include Lihui Zhang, Jianming Zhang, Zhipeng Xie, Juan Sun, Jin Wang, Qian Zhang, Yongping Sun, Qingyou Yan, Ying Yang and Nan Huang. Their work appears in journals such as IEEE Access, Energy and Sustainability.
